I took a trip to Vegas last weekend. Had good times, lost a pile of money, etc. On hwy 15, they have implemented these neat little speed detectors on downhills, shows you how fast you are going and tells you to slow down. A great safety measure, infinitely better than camping police cars that make idiots slam their brakes.
So, I'm cruising along and I pass the first such signs, it is flashing that I am travelling at 72mph. Hmm... my speedo is showing 80.... but whatever. Between LV and LA there are at least 3 such signs, so I made sure to check the speedo at each sign. I was slightly perturbed to see that the speedo was off by 5 ~ 7 mph ( I drove back a few times to make sure it was right, and well, it's fun to see how big the numbers go.)
I know that it isn't uncommon for speedo's to be off, but I've never had a car that was off by this much. Hopefully its just my car. I'd take it to the dealer to have em check it out but I can't come up with a good excuse to give to the techie.

I recall this being discussed before and the speedometers were reading 2mph faster than the 8 was travelling.
I took a portable GPS with a speed reading out with the 8 and found mine to be consistantly 1.8 mph slower than the speedometer output. Tested at various speeds
5-7mph off is excessive better check it out.

German magazine Auto Motor und Sport tested the RX-8 about a year ago.
The inaccuracy was 3 km/h at every speed tested.
I.e. the speedo showed 3 km/h more than real speed.
They tested it up to 160km/h.
